XML 44 R35.htm IDEA: XBRL DOCUMENT v3.3.0.814
Acquisitions (Schedule of Finite-Lived Intangible Assets Acquired as Part of Business Combination) (Details) - USD ($)
$ in Thousands
9 Months Ended
Sep. 30, 2015
Sep. 30, 2014
Acquired Finite-Lived Intangible Assets [Line Items]    
Amortization of intangibles $ 1,301 $ 239
Titan Energy Worldwide Inc. [Member]    
Acquired Finite-Lived Intangible Assets [Line Items]    
Finite-lived intangible assets acquired 5,147  
Amortization of intangibles $ 978  
Titan Energy Worldwide Inc. [Member] | Customer Relationships [Member]    
Acquired Finite-Lived Intangible Assets [Line Items]    
Amortization period of identifiable intangible assets 4 years  
Amortization of intangibles $ 4,320  
Titan Energy Worldwide Inc. [Member] | Distributor Territory License [Member]    
Acquired Finite-Lived Intangible Assets [Line Items]    
Amortization period of identifiable intangible assets 4 years  
Amortization of intangibles $ 474  
Titan Energy Worldwide Inc. [Member] | Internally Developed Software [Member]    
Acquired Finite-Lived Intangible Assets [Line Items]    
Amortization period of identifiable intangible assets 7 years  
Amortization of intangibles $ 289  
Titan Energy Worldwide Inc. [Member] | Trade Names [Member]    
Acquired Finite-Lived Intangible Assets [Line Items]    
Amortization period of identifiable intangible assets 1 year  
Amortization of intangibles $ 64